Kanda Hama Village Polpulation

Kanda Hama is a Village located in the Taluka of Beerwah, in the district of Badgam district, in the state of Jammu and Kashmir state with a total population of 1471. There are 190 houses in the Village.

Kanda Hama Population by Sex

There are total of 833 male persons and 638 females and a total number of 259 children below 6 years in Kanda Hama.
The percentage of male population is 56.63%.
The percentage of female population is 43.37%.
The percentage of child population is 17.61%.
